x86_of_pci_init() does two things: - it provides a generic irq enable and disable function. enable queries the device tree for the interrupt information, calls ->xlate on the irq host and updates the pci->irq information for the device.
- it walks through PCI buss(es) in the device tree and adds its children (devices) nodes to appropriate pci_dev nodes in kernel. So the dtb node information is available at probe time of the PCI device.
Adding a PCI bus based on the information in the device tree is currently not supported. Right now direct access via ioports is used.
